Regulators Bring the Safety Net
Here’s the deal: bodies like the UK Gambling Commission or Malta Gaming Authority lock down standards. They audit software, enforce AML protocols, and demand transparent odds. In practice, that means you get a fair game, a clear audit trail, and a legal avenue if something goes south. No licence, no guarantee, just a gamble on trust.
Financial Trust: Money Moves Under Scrutiny
By the way, licensed operators must segregate player deposits from operational cash. This segregation stops the classic “vanishing funds” scam. When a platform is audited, those funds sit in a protected account, ready for withdrawal whenever you demand. The alternative? A black‑hole where every deposit disappears.
Player Protection and Responsible Gaming
And here is why responsible gaming policies matter. Regulators force operators to implement self‑exclusion tools, betting limits, and age verification. That’s not just a nice‑to‑have feature; it’s a legal shield that keeps vulnerable players from spiraling. Unlicensed sites skip this stuff, leaving addicts exposed to endless losses.
Choosing Wisely: The Real‑World Impact
When you surf the digital casino floor, the license badge is your compass. It tells you the game is vetted, the payout is genuine, and the company can’t just vanish overnight. Missing that badge? Walk away. A quick scan of the footer for a licence number, cross‑checked on the regulator’s site, saves you from countless headaches.
